This report focuses on strategies for building effective and consistent team structures within a pharmaceutical context, specifically addressing drug development programs. It emphasizes the importance of high-performance work teams, highlighting their reliance on experienced individuals working towards common goals with clear communication and defined roles. The report outlines key strategies, including identifying training needs, selecting appropriate training methods like on-job training and active training, implementing team-building activities to identify strengths and weaknesses, delegating work effectively to empower team members, managing talent by identifying and developing skilled individuals, and establishing succession planning to retain crucial knowledge and skills. References from academic sources support the strategies presented, making it a useful resource for understanding and implementing successful team structures in the pharmaceutical industry.

Making the right choice of training methods: Some of the most common method
improving the skill of individual is On-job training. In this mode of training, some people work
alongside most experienced colleague (McDavid, Huse & Hawthorn, 2018). Apart from this,
active training can be done where training can be given for playing roles so that the leaners can
be engaged.

Succession Planning: As soon as the team have the ability of team members and level of
performance, they can plan the whole thing so that they do not lose some of the important skills
(McDavid, Huse & Hawthorn, 2018). Good succession planning mainly tends to ensure the fact
that they have enough skills, knowledge and overall experience.
